Abstract

The present invention discloses a wheelchair with single rotation driven three attitude changes. The wheelchair with single rotation driven three attitude changes comprises: a seat, a backrest, a legrest, a vehicle wheel frame, a locking rod and a driving mechanism; a middle part of a bottom surface of the seat is hingedly provided with a bracket, the bracket and the seat surrounds a quadrangularstructure, and besides, each edge of the bracket is hingedly connected to each other; a bottom part front side of the backrest is hingedly connected a seat rear side, and a bottom part rear side is fixedly connected with a rear side edge of the bracket; an upper part of the leg rest is hingedly connected with the seat and the bracket; a top part of the vehicle wheel frame is hingedly arranged ata hinge part of the seat and the bracket; the locking rod is inclinedly arranged, one end of the locking rod is disconnectably hinged with a rear side of the seat, the other end is disconnectably hinged with a lower part of the leg rest, and a middle part is hingedly connected with the vehicle wheel frame; and an output end of the driving mechanism is arranged at the hinged part of the seat and the bracket, and the driving mechanism is used for driving the quadrilateral surrounded by the bracket and the seat to move to conduct deformation to realize the attitude changes of the wheelchair. Onlyone rotation driving is needed and the driven clockwise and counterclockwise rotations realize the three attitude changes and motion coordination of the wheelchair.

technical field [0001] The invention relates to the technical field of wheelchairs, and more specifically, the invention relates to a wheelchair with single-rotation drive and three-posture transformation. Background technique [0002] As a kind of auxiliary means of transportation, wheelchairs are in urgent need of both the elderly and disabled people with physical dysfunction. In response to the actual needs of people who rely on wheelchairs for daily mobility and rehabilitation training, many research institutions and companies at home and abroad have designed three-position wheelchairs, but most of the three-position wheelchairs are based on multiple quadrilateral linkage mechanisms, crank-slider mechanisms, and crank rockers. Mechanisms such as rod mechanism adopt two or more drives (such as electric push rods) to realize three-position transformation, which has a complex structure and heavy wheelchair body.
